site stats

Fortran float invalid operation

WebJan 30, 2024 · The Intel Fortran compiler generally uses IEEE arithmetic. The "floating invalid" message is a result of an unhandled IEEE exception of an invalid operation. … WebMPI_FLOAT float MPI_DOUBLE double MPI_LONG_DOUBLE long double (some systems may not implement this) ... MPI_ORDER_FORTRAN Column-major order (as used by Fortran) MPI_DISTRIBUTE_BLOCK Block distribution ... Invalid operation MPI_ERR_TOPOLOGY Invalid topology MPI_ERR_DIMS Illegal dimension argument …

Detecting and trapping floating-point exceptions - IBM

Webselect "Access violation" and all "Float..." exceptions & check "stop always" radio button. (You need to do this only once in a lifetime.) - Now hit F5 -- when invalid float operation is encountered, you'll get an "Unhandled exception in Brisi.exe (KERNEL32.DLL): 0xC0000090: Float Invalid Operation." message box. Hit OK. WebOct 16, 2024 · If the exception results from an operation on an uninitialized floating-point variable, you will typically see the message: forrtl: error (182): floating invalid - possible … gorsuch sex discrimination https://serranosespecial.com

[Patch, libfortran] Thread safety and simplification of error printing

WebTopcy House Consulting. You might consider checking whether the divisor is 0 before trying to evaluate the expression. then if it is zero, and you are not expecting that, you can stop and print a ... WebJun 2, 2024 · forrtl: error (65): floating invalid And it references the specified line in the code. When I look at the print outs for Te during time step 50 the entry for i=4 is a 'NaN' … WebThe GNU Fortran Compiler. Next: FLOOR, Previous: FGETC, Up: Intrinsic Procedures. 6.65 FLOAT — Convert integer to default real. Description: FLOAT(I) converts the … chico ca therapy

powerpc64le-linux-gnu-gcc-4.8 - Online na nuvem

Category:setfileoption - University Corporation for Atmospheric Research

Tags:Fortran float invalid operation

Fortran float invalid operation

IEEE Floating-Point Arithmetic (Fortran Programming …

WebAssigning values p = 2.0 q = 3.0 i = 2 j = 3 ! floating point division realRes = p/q intRes = i/j print *, realRes print *, intRes end program division When you compile and execute the above program it produces the following result − 0.666666687 0 Complex Type This is used for storing complex numbers. WebJul 21, 2010 · array. A homogeneous container of numerical elements. Each element in the array occupies a fixed amount of memory (hence homogeneous), and can be a numerical element of a single type (such as float, int or complex) or a combination (such as (float, int, float) ). Each array has an associated data-type (or dtype ), which describes the …

Fortran float invalid operation

Did you know?

WebAs stated earlier, the IEEE standard for floating-point arithmetic defines a number of exception (or error) conditions that might require special care to avoid or recover from. The following sections are intended to help you make your programs work safely in the presence of such exception conditions WebJul 19, 2024 · The below code is giving me error: Msg 3623, Level 16, State 1, Line 27. An invalid floating point operation occurred. declare @lat1 as float. declare @long1 as float. declare @lat2 as float ...

WebIn most cases, the only indication that any floating-point exceptions (such as overflow, underflow, or invalid operation) have occurred is the retrospective summary message … WebInvalid Operation Raised when the requested computation cannot be performed. If no trap handler is specified, the result is a NaN. Division by Zero If no trap handler is specified, the result is infinity. Overflow If no trap handler is specified, the result is rounded based on the current rounding mode. Underflow Same behavior as overflow

WebInteger arithmetic in Fortran can lead to other weird surprises - for instance, the distributive law of division is invalid, as demonstrated by the example (2 + 3)/4 = 5/4 = 1 but (2/4) + (3/4) = 0 + 0 = 0 . ... If Fortran is asked in some arithmetic operation to combine an integer number with a real one, usually it will wait until it is forced ... WebJan 6, 2024 · The result of a floating point operation cannot be represented exactly as a decimal fraction. This value is defined as STATUS_FLOAT_INEXACT_RESULT. …

WebFloating-Point Exceptions and Fortran Programs compiled by f77 automatically display a list of accrued floating-point exceptions on program termination. In general, a message …

WebJul 18, 2024 · @ Simon Atanasyan Many thanks for your advices. As you can see from Mesa's rpmbuild SPEC file, there is a compilation dependency between the Mesa package and llvm/clang, as shown below. gorsuch snow globesWebOct 16, 2024 · If the exception results from an operation on an uninitialized floating-point variable, you will typically see the message: forrtl: error (182): floating invalid - possible uninitialized real/complex variable. If the “arrays” argument is omitted, uninitialized scalars will be detected, but uninitialized array elements will not. gorsuch shearlingWebException: INVALID operation. Signaled by the raising of the INVALID flag whenever an operation's operands lie outside its domain, this exception's default, delivered only because any other real or infinite value would most likely cause worse confusion, is NaN , which means “ Not a Number.” chico ca theaterWebNov 3, 2015 · With the intel fortran compiler (ifort), using the option -fpe0 will do the same thing. It's a little tricker with C/C++ code; we have to actually insert a call to feenableexcept (), which enables floating point exceptions, and is defined in fenv.h; gorsuch sides with liberal judgesWebJan 21, 2009 · I am getting an invalid floating point operation error in release mode, which is not the case in the debug mode.I do not think thatthis is because of project setting differences between these two modes, since I already tried almost every combination. gorsuch senate vote countWebPROGRAMA: NOME gcc - compilador C e C ++ do projeto GNU SINOPSE gcc [-c -S -E] [-std =padrão] [-g] [-pg] [-Onível] [-Wavisar...] [-Wpedantic] [-Idir...] [-Ldir ... gorsuch sotomayor dissentWebSee Fortran User's Guide for details on this compiler option. For example, to enable trapping for overflow, division by zero, and invalid operations, compile with -ftrap=common. Note - You must compile the application's main program with -ftrap= for trapping to be enabled. Floating-Point Exceptions and Fortran gorsuch sotomayor masks